McLaren announce Paul Di Resta as reserve for Silverstone

70th Anniversary Grand Prix – Paul Di Resta will serve as McLaren's official reserve driver for this weekend's race at Silverstone, the team have confirmed. McLaren have confirmed Paul Di Resta as their reserve driver for this weekend's race at Silverstone.
